The cheapest way to get from Stony Brook to Long Beach is to drive which costs $7 - $12 and takes 1h.
The fastest way to get from Stony Brook to Long Beach is to drive which takes 1h and costs $7 - $12.
No, there is no direct bus from Stony Brook to Long Beach. However, there are services departing from Stony Brook LIRR and arriving at Long Beach Rd / E Park via Smith Haven Mall, Amityville Sta and Hemp Trans Ctr / Columbia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 55m.
No, there is no direct train from Stony Brook to Long Beach. However, there are services departing from Stony Brook and arriving at Long Beach via Jamaica.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 10m.
The distance between Stony Brook and Long Beach is 57 miles. The road distance is 43.1 miles.
The best way to get from Stony Brook to Long Beach without a car is to train which takes 2h 10m and costs $14 - $35.
It takes approximately 2h 10m to get from Stony Brook to Long Beach, including transfers.
Stony Brook to Long Beach bus services, operated by Suffolk County Transit, depart from Smith Haven Mall station.
Stony Brook to Long Beach train services, operated by Long Island Rail Road, depart from Stony Brook station.
The best way to get from Stony Brook to Long Beach is to train which takes 2h 10m and costs $14 - $35. Alternatively, you can line 4 bus and bus, which costs $12 and takes 4h 55m.
